Instructions. Begin by selecting and washing your tomatoes. If blanching, boil water in a large pot. Make a small "x" on the opposite side from the stem and place tomatoes into boiling water for 2 minutes, until the skin starts to peel back slightly. Immediately scoop up tomatoes and transfer them to an ice bath.
